Mid- level R&D Machine Learning Engineer

Athens, Attica, Greece

DeepLab

Custom Machine Learning Solutions

View all jobs at DeepLab

Apply now Apply later

Deeplab combines high-end software technologies with state-of-the-art advanced machine learning and deep learning research to provide services and products that face challenging real-life problems. This is your chance to join a dynamic and rapidly evolving ML/AI organization committed to research, innovation, and excellence.

We foster a fresh culture that bridges academic rigor with entrepreneurial agility, creating an environment where methodical research meets real-world impact and fast-paced innovation. This synergy fuels our mission to solve complex, meaningful problems using cutting-edge machine learning.

The Team

We are currently expanding our R&D teams, dealing with disruptive high risk/high impact projects from ideation to proposal compilation, proof of concept development and final project delivery, combining innovative DL/ML concepts with cutting-edge production technologies. Projects in the overall group deal with a diverse list of topics such as adTech systems that serves millions daily users, drug discovery with virtual screening of billions of molecules, cancer immunotherapies, brain computer interfaces and so on. You will be joining an interdisciplinary team comprising passionate ML engineers with backgrounds in both research and software development.

The Role

We seek an outstanding and enthusiastic Mid-level ML Engineer with an exceptional engineering background and proven both research and hands-on development record, who shares our passion for problem-solving applied to challenging problems. You will get the chance to work closely with ML engineers, interdisciplinary domain experts and software developers to explore, prototype, and implement proof of concepts and algorithms that address real-world problems. You will also support the technical preparation of proposals for a variety of funded research and innovation grant applications and projects. This is a great opportunity to grow technically and intellectually while making a tangible contribution to both applied ML systems and R&D initiatives.

Responsibilities

  1. Design, develop and implement machine learning/deep learning algorithms.
  2. Problem solving, solution formulation, DL/ML architecture and pipeline design and development. 
  3. Conduct ML experimentation and benchmarking.
  4. PoC development incorporating new state-of-the-art after in-depth literature survey in diverse research topics and applications.
  5. Perform statistical modeling, data analytics.
  6. Manage and preprocess datasets to ensure consistency and quality.
  7. Optimize models for scalability and efficiency.
  8. Support the planning, execution, and delivery of projects.
  9. Participate in knowledge-sharing and improvement within the team.
  10. Contribute to the preparation, compilation and creative writing of technical content with up to date state of the art reviews for challenging EU grant and industrial proposals.
  11. Collaborate across disciplines in cross-functional international teams.
  12. Stay current with ML research and developments relevant to Deeplab’s work.

Requirements

  1. MSc (Electrical & Comp. Eng., Machine Learning, CS), and experience in implementing and benchmarking machine learning algorithms for real-world data.
  2. Strong requirement: 2+ total years of in-depth hands-on industrial and academic experience in machine learning projects in areas such as deep learning, core ML, computer vision, natural language processing etc. Industrial experience is a requirement.
  3. Strong understanding of statistical and mathematical principles underlying machine learning algorithms.
  4. Candidates should be proficient in Python, with experience developing, testing, and maintaining production-grade machine learning applications using frameworks such as TensorFlow or PyTorch.
  5. Experience with technical writing both in terms of research proposals and scientific/tech papers.
  6. Familiar with development processes using Linux, versioning, CI/CD, Docker etc.
  7. Ability to analyze complex problems and develop innovative solutions.
  8. Ability to collaborate in challenging international environments.
  9. Excellent written and oral communication skills; ability to present complex analyses in a clear, concise and actionable manner.
  10. Nice to have: experience with large scale cluster computing for machine learning modeling.

Benefits

  • Supplementary private health insurance.
  • Flexible working hours and remote work opportunities.
  • Work in high-end AI-tech and contribute to real-world impact.
  • Budget for home office equipment and productivity.
  • Personal development budget and knowledge-sharing sessions.
  • Newly designed and inspiring office environment.
  • Competitive salary based on experience and qualifications.
Apply now Apply later

* Salary range is an estimate based on our AI, ML, Data Science Salary Index 💰

Job stats:  1  1  0

Tags: Architecture CI/CD Computer Vision Core ML Data Analytics Deep Learning Docker Drug discovery Engineering Industrial Linux Machine Learning NLP Python PyTorch R R&D Research Statistical modeling Statistics TensorFlow Testing

Perks/benefits: Career development Competitive pay Flex hours Gear Health care

Region: Europe
Country: Greece

More jobs like this